Roofing Maintenance in Springtime



Spring is the excellent time to evaluate your roofing system for any type of damages and do needed maintenance. As the climate warms up, it's essential to look for any signs of wear and tear that might have taken place throughout the rough winter months.

Beginning by checking out the roof shingles for any type of cracks, missing items, or crinkling sides. These problems can bring about leaks otherwise attended to immediately. Clear any particles such as leaves, branches, or moss that may have accumulated on the roof covering, as these can catch wetness and trigger damage in time.

Inspect the seamless gutters for clogs or damage, making sure that they're free from any obstructions to enable proper drain. Cut any kind of looming branches that might potentially damage the roofing during windy conditions.

Summer Roofing System Inspection Tips



As the summer season shows up, it's necessary to conduct a thorough evaluation of your roofing system to guarantee it stays in optimal problem. Begin by checking out the tiles for any type of signs of damages, such as splits, crinkling, or missing pieces.

Inspect the gutters for particles accumulation that can bring about water pooling and possible leakages. Trim any overhanging tree branches that can harm the roof covering during summer season storms. Evaluate the flashing around smokeshafts, vents, and skylights to see to it they're secure and closed correctly.

Look for any type of indications of mold, algae, or moss development, particularly in shaded locations. In addition, examine the attic for any kind of indicators of water spots, mold, or bugs that might show a roofing trouble. By performing a comprehensive summertime roof covering evaluation, you can deal with any type of issues early and guarantee your roof is ready to endure the heat and tornados of the period.

Fall and Winter Season Roof Covering Treatment



Checking and preserving your roofing throughout the fall and cold weather is crucial to ensuring its long life and defense against extreme climate condition.

As the leaves start to drop, ensure to on a regular basis cleanse your gutters and get rid of any type of debris that can obstruct drainage. Clogged up gutters can bring about water back-up, triggering damages to your roof covering and home.

Check for any type of loosened or damaged roof shingles that could be susceptible to strong winds and hefty snow. Secure or replace them promptly to avoid leaks and water infiltration.

During winter season, keep an eye out for ice dams, which create when snow thaws and refreezes on the roofing's edge, possibly creating water to seep under the shingles. Utilize a roofing system rake to securely eliminate excess snow build-up and avoid ice dam formation.


Protect your attic to maintain a regular temperature on your roof covering and reduce the danger of ice dams.
